The NTX-2000-12 Samlex Amer Ntx Series Pure Sine Wave Inverter is designed to deliver reliable and clean power for your electrical devices. With its pure sine wave output, this inverter is capable of safely powering sensitive electronics.
Q: What is the Samlex NTX Series Pure Sine Wave Inverter (S6ANTX200012)?
A: A 2000W pure sine wave 12V DC to 120V AC inverter designed for off-grid, RV, marine, and backup power systems, delivering clean, stable electricity for sensitive and heavy electrical loads.
Q: What does the S6ANTX200012 do?
A: It converts 12V battery power into standard 120V household AC power, allowing you to run appliances like microwaves, tools, laptops, and other electronics off-grid.
Q: What is the power output?
A: It provides 2000 watts continuous power with approximately 4000 watts surge capacity for starting motors and high-inrush loads.
Q: What type of waveform does it produce?
A: It produces a pure sine wave output, meaning cleaner, utility-grade power that is safe for sensitive electronics and medical devices.
Q: What are the input and output specs?
A: It runs on 12V DC input and outputs ~115–120V AC at 60Hz, matching standard North American household electricity.
Q: What safety and protection features does it include?
A: It typically includes low voltage cutoff, overload protection, over-temperature protection, short-circuit protection, and input fault protection, ensuring safe continuous operation.
Q: Where is it commonly used?
A: It is widely used in solar power systems, RVs, boats, mobile workstations, construction sites, and emergency backup systems.
Q: What makes the NTX series different from lower-cost inverters?
A: The NTX series is designed for higher efficiency, lower idle power draw, stronger surge handling, and cleaner power output, making it more reliable for continuous heavy-duty use.
Q: What should users consider before installing it?
A: Because it’s a 2000W 12V inverter, it requires a strong battery bank and properly sized thick DC cables, since current draw on the battery side is very high under load.
Q: Is it suitable for solar setups?
A: Yes. It integrates well with 12V solar battery systems, especially where stable pure sine wave power is needed for household-style appliances.
